Reflecting on our 2025 accomplishments

As the APA Washington Board and volunteers dive into our 2026 work program, it’s worth pausing to celebrate what we accomplished together in 2025. If you’re looking for proof that we had a strong year, the 2025 APA WA Annual Report tells the story.

A few highlights:

  • Membership remained strong and engagement stayed high, thanks to dedicated volunteers, board members, and section leaders across the state. We also elected new leadership, bringing fresh ideas and energy to the chapter.
  • Our annual conference in Tacoma was a standout success, welcoming a record number of planners for learning, connection, and inspiration. We also recognized five individuals for their contributions to the field.
  • Sections across the chapter delivered meaningful professional development throughout the year, helping members earn CM credits, sharpen skills, and stay current on planning issues.
  • Behind the scenes, APA WA continued to strengthen its operations and finances, maintaining a solid, resilient foundation for the future.

The takeaway? 2025 was a year worth celebrating—and it set us up well for what’s next. I encourage you to take a few minutes to explore the full Annual Report. It’s a snapshot of what you helped make possible and a reminder of the momentum we’re building together across the Chapter.
